Output 75c497d62b692a78a60c6614828d140365f19de740183ea5bd683fadba4364e0:12

value
41058800
script pubkey
OP_0 OP_PUSHBYTES_20 b5e70caab7c6c53fb84a439a5e5c5e228be63d1a
address
ltc1qkhnse24hcmznlwz2gwd9uhz7y297v0g629xejq
transaction
75c497d62b692a78a60c6614828d140365f19de740183ea5bd683fadba4364e0
spent
true